Practical Guidance for Implementation
Choosing a display font requires more than just liking how it looks in a preview. First, consider your project's primary goal. Is it readability at small sizes? If so, the sans serif font included in the Delight Script family is your workhorse for body copy and supporting text. The script style is best reserved for larger applications where its details can be appreciated. Always test the font in context. Set your actual headlines, not just "Lorem ipsum," and view it at the size and on the background color you intend to use. Check the spacing between letters and words—what looks good in a font specimen sheet might need kerning adjustments in your design.
Evaluating font pairings is crucial. Delight Script's elegance pairs well with clean, geometric sans serif fonts for a modern look, or with a classic, sturdy serif font for a more traditional feel. Avoid pairing it with other highly decorative or script fonts, as this creates visual competition and confusion. Review the full character map. Look for stylistic alternates for key letters like 'g', 's', or 'r' that might better suit your aesthetic. Finally, understand the licensing. As a commercial font, ensure the license covers your intended use, whether it's for a client project, merchandise, or digital products. Proper licensing is a non-negotiable part of professional practice, protecting both you and the font's creators.
